At its core, Thinking Blocks uses customizable “blocks” shaped like decision-making or problem-solving units. These blocks guide you through structured stages: identifying key elements, weighing pros and cons, exploring alternatives, and shaping a clear conclusion—all without relying solely on fluid verbal expression.
Think of it as mental scaffolding: while words falter, the block structure supports your thinking, making your messages sharp, purposeful, and easy to understand.
